Since the arrival of her widely lauded debut EP 3:33am, Amber Mark’s voice has performed a powerful alchemy, often turning pain and heartache into extraordinary beauty. When matched with her prismatic musicality – an element shaped by her nomadic upbringing, including time spent in New York City, Miami, Berlin, India, Thailand, and Nepal – the Tennessee-born artist’s spellbinding vocals and lavish storytelling often create a sensation of rapturous surrender. In a departure from her past work’s existential soul-searching and nuanced reflection on grief, Mark’s sophomore album Pretty Idea journeys into lighter but no less layered emotional terrain: the ache and chaos and occasional euphoria of falling deep into an impossible romance. Steeped in a warm and groove-driven sound that hits every pleasure center, the result is a daring leap forward for one of modern music’s most fascinating singer/songwriters.
The follow-up to Three Dimensions Deep (a 2022 LP praised by the likes of Pitchfork, Stereogum, and NPR), Pretty Idea finds Mark joining forces with several of her frequent collaborators, including leading producers like Julian Bunetta (Teddy Swims, Gracie Abrams), John Ryan (Sabrina Carpenter, Niall Horan), and Two Fresh (Mac Miller, Samara Cyn). “Because I was so comfortable with everyone I worked with on this album, I felt really free to express myself creatively – there was none of the anxiety that’s sometimes consumed me in the past,” she says. Not only evident in her unfettered vocal work, that sense of freedom manifests in the lovely fluidity of Pretty Idea’s sonic palette – a gorgeously orchestrated fusion of R&B, indie-folk, soul, funk, dream-pop, and more. “Even though a lot of these songs are about heartbreak and the end of a long-term relationship, the record still feels really fun and joyful,” notes Mark, naming yacht-rock legends like The Doobie Brothers and Steely Dan among her touchstones for the album.
Following the breakout success of 3:33am, Mark gained further acclaim with her 2018 sophomore EP Conexão, earned a GRAMMY nomination for her contribution to Chromeo’s chart-topping LP Head over Heels, and captivated audiences at major festivals like Coachella, Outside Lands, and Pitchfork. Now based in Southern California – where she lives within walking distance of her closest collaborators in a remote area she refers to as “my little artist oasis” – Mark thrives on immersing herself in the singular thrill of creative exploration.
“There’s so many different styles of music I want to experiment with – sometimes I worry I’ll never get to make everything I want to make in one lifetime,” she says. “With this album I fulfilled the dream of creating a type of sound I’d always loved, but I’m not really interested in staying with that sound forever. As an artist I’m ever-changing and ever-growing, and I know my roots will keep on spreading in all different directions.”
